Question

Does the potential energy of an object near the surface of the Earth change if it moves with constant velocity in the horizontal direction? What if the object is gradually raised in the vertical direction?

Long Answer
Advertisements

Solution

U = mgh, which is dependent on the item's height h above the Earth's surface, is the potential energy of an object close to the surface.

The object's height h remains constant when it travels horizontally at a constant speed. As a result, its potential energy remains constant.

The object's height h grows as it is gradually raised vertically. Its potential energy rises as a result.
